Background: The Legal Dispute Between Blake Lively and Justin Baldoni

blake lively

The drama off-screen started when Blake Lively accused Justin Baldoni, who directed and starred alongside her in It Ends With Us (2024), of sexual harassment during production. Lively also alleged that Baldoni launched a campaign to damage her professional reputation and personal life.

Baldoni responded with a countersuit, claiming defamation and accusing Blake, her husband Ryan Reynolds, their publicist, and The New York Times of attempting to destroy his career with false allegations.

The legal battle has been complex, with several lawsuits filed by both parties. However, courts have largely ruled in favor of Blake so far. A key moment came in June 2025 when a judge dismissed Baldoni’s countersuits, affirming that Lively’s sexual harassment claims are legally protected.

The Deposition Sealing: Judge Lewis Liman’s Landmark Decision

One of the most significant and recent developments came in August 2025. Blake Lively’s deposition a detailed, nearly 300-page transcript of her sworn testimony was set to be publicly filed as part of the court record.

However, Judge Lewis Liman, overseeing the case, stepped in and ruled that the deposition must be sealed and kept out of the public eye.

Judge Criticizes Baldoni’s Legal Team for Tactics

In a strongly worded court order, the judge sharply criticized the legal team representing Baldoni and his production company, Wayfarer Studios. The team had attached the entire deposition transcript to court filings but only referenced two pages in their legal arguments.

Judge Liman wrote:

“The Wayfarer Parties’ attachment of the entire, nearly 300-page deposition—after citing only two pages of it in the Letter served no proper litigation purpose and instead appears to have been intended to burden Lively (and as a result, the Court) and to invite public speculation and scandal.”

He went further:

“Even if the cited deposition portions were relevant… the Wayfarer Parties have not even attempted to argue that the entire deposition was relevant. Nor could they.”

The judge concluded that Baldoni’s lawyers submitted excessive irrelevant pages with the intent to cause trouble and to use Blake’s legal motions to keep them sealed as a public relations tactic. The court emphasized its duty not to allow such manipulation.

Consequently, Judge Liman granted Blake Lively’s motion to strike the deposition transcript from the court docket, ensuring it remains confidential and unavailable to media or the public.

Why Is This Sealing So Important?

Depositions are critical parts of legal proceedings. They contain detailed accounts of the person’s testimony and can include sensitive information. If released publicly, Blake’s deposition could have exposed her to intense media scrutiny and public speculation beyond the courtroom.

By sealing it, the court protects Blake’s privacy, allowing the trial to focus on legal merits rather than turning into a media spectacle.

The Strange Pay-Per-View Proposal

Adding an unusual chapter to the story, Justin Baldoni’s attorney, Bryan Freedman, suggested that Blake’s deposition be held as a pay-per-view event at Madison Square Garden. He claimed this could raise funds for domestic abuse charities and “make it count.”

This idea, reported widely in the media, was met with skepticism and was firmly rejected by the court. It further demonstrated how high-profile and controversial this case has become, mixing legal seriousness with public relations stunts.

What Happens Next? The Upcoming Trial

The trial is set to begin in March 2026, with both Blake Lively and Justin Baldoni expected to testify. The judge has made it clear that cameras will not be allowed in the courtroom, emphasizing the need for privacy and fairness in legal proceedings.
